The Ultimate Guide to Choosing a Small Wood Burning Stove

A small wood burning stove adds warmth and charm to any space. These stoves are perfect for cabins, workshops, or tiny homes. They provide efficient heat without taking up much room. If you want to stay cozy, this guide will help you pick the right one.

1. Key Features to Look For

When shopping, look for an adjustable air vent. This feature lets you control how fast the wood burns. A large glass window is also important. It lets you watch the fire and makes the room feel brighter. You should also check for an ash pan. This makes cleaning up the stove much easier.

2. Important Materials

Most stoves use either cast iron or steel.

  • Cast Iron: These stoves hold heat for a long time. They look classic and heavy. However, they can crack if they get too cold and then heat up too fast.
  • Steel: These stoves heat up very quickly. They are lighter and often more modern in design. They are very durable and resist cracking.

3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

High-quality stoves have tight seals around the door. These seals prevent smoke from leaking into your room. Good stoves also use firebricks inside the firebox. These bricks protect the metal walls from high heat. Avoid stoves with thin metal walls. Thin metal will warp or burn out after only a few seasons of use. Always check for an EPA certification. This label means the stove burns wood cleanly and efficiently.

4. User Experience and Use Cases

Think about where you will put the stove. A small stove works well in a garage or a hobby shed. It also works as a backup heat source in a house during a power outage. Most users enjoy the “crackling” sound of a fire. Remember that you must clear space around the stove for safety. Keep all furniture and curtains far away from the heat.

10 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I use a small stove in a bedroom?

A: Yes, but you must follow strict safety rules. Ensure the stove is approved for indoor use and install a carbon monoxide detector nearby.

Q: How often do I need to clean the chimney?

A: Clean your chimney at least once a year. If you use the stove daily, you may need to clean it twice a year to prevent soot buildup.

Q: What kind of wood should I burn?

A: Always use dry, seasoned hardwood. Wet wood creates too much smoke and clogs your chimney.

Q: Do I need a professional to install the stove?

A: It is highly recommended. A professional ensures the stove meets all local fire codes.

Q: Can I cook on top of a small wood stove?

A: Many models have a flat top surface designed for a kettle or a small pot.

Q: Does a small stove need a floor pad?

A: Yes. You must place the stove on a non-flammable surface like stone, tile, or a metal hearth pad.

Q: How long does one load of wood last?

A: It depends on the size of the firebox and the air setting. Most small stoves burn for 3 to 6 hours per load.

Q: Will this stove heat my whole house?

A: Small stoves are meant for single rooms or small cabins. They usually cannot heat an entire large house.

Q: Is the outside of the stove hot to the touch?

A: Yes, the exterior gets extremely hot. Never touch the stove while it is in use, especially if children or pets are nearby.

Q: How do I know if the stove is efficient?

A: Look for the EPA-certified sticker. This shows the stove burns wood completely and produces less pollution.
